Effects of oxidants on the degradation of tributyl phosphate under supercritical water oxidation conditions

The effects of additional oxidants, such as NaNO 3 , Na 2 S 2 O 3 , KClO 4 , and K 2 Cr 2 O 7 , on the supercritical water oxidation (SCWO) of tributyl phosphate (TBP) were studied. The coupling of an ionic oxidant with SCWO can effectively enhance the oxidative degradation ability of the system, thus increasing its organic-matter-removal efficiency at a reduced reaction temperature. Moreover, the addition of NaNO 3 , KClO 4 , or K 2 Cr 2 O 7 could improve this efficiency at a reaction temperature of 500 °C compared with that of the original system at 550 °C. Additionally, based on the conditions adopted in this study, the addition of either of these oxidants could reduce the final total organic carbon (TOC) of the effluent from ~ 500 to < 100 ppm. Concurrently, the ionic oxidants could effectively improve the processing capacity of the SCWO system to reduce the scale of the equipment, as well as the amount of produced wastewater. Compared with KClO 4 and Na 2 S 2 O 3 , the addition of 10 mmol/L NaNO 3 and K 2 Cr 2 O 7 to the organic feed could increase the processing capacity of the system from 4 to 10% while maintaining the TOC removal at > 99%. The effects of the ionic oxidants on the gas products, including CO 2 , CO, H 2 , and CH 4 , as well as other organic gases, have also been studied. Among these gas products, CO 2 accounted for the main gas product with a proportion of more than half. At < 500 °C, temperature significantly affected the as products (CO, H 2 , CH 4 , and other organic gases). However, the gas product was mainly CO 2 when the temperature was increased to ≥ 500 °C. This study initially revealed the enhancement effect of ionic oxidants on SCWO, which still requires further research.
